Adaptive iterative particle filter and its application for ship integrated navigation

Abstract:

In multi-sensor integrated navigation, extensive observation information and low sampling efficiency will lead to poor navigation performance. An adaptive iterated particle filter is presented and applied in global positioning system/inertial navigation system integrated navigation. Firstly, importance density function is updated iteratively by the particle filter itself. Secondly, by using a simulated annealing algorithm with an adaptive annealing parameter, the current measurement can be quickly incorporated into the sampling process, resulting in greatly improved sampling efficiency. Finally, the performance of the proposed method is examined on the sea trail and the simulation experiment, respectively. The results show that the method can provide better navigation accuracy and improve performance of the filter.
